Steven S. Shagrin, JD, CFP®, CRPC®, CRC®, RLP®, CMC, is President of
Planning For Life, a holistic life transition, life planning and retirement education company. Better known as "Shags," he is dedicated to providing lifelong learning for adults of any age and at any life stage through his one-on-one meetings, small-group workshops, and distance-learning sessions. He has 25 years experience in retirement financial planning and modeling, and nearly 20 years as a financial consultant. Steven is also an attorney, Certified Financial Planner licensee, Chartered Retirement Planning Counselor®, Certified Retirement Counselor®, and an Enhanced Lifestyle Planner. He is general editor of "Facts About Retiring in the United States" (H.W. Wilson, 2001) and author of "Managing My Life: Managing My Money” (Heart & Spirit, Inc., 2006). Steven received his B.B.A. from the University of Miami (FL) and his J.D. from Case Western Reserve University, with an emphasis in tax and estate planning.
